Question to the Department for Work and Pensions:

To ask the Secretary of State for Work and Pensions, what estimate he has made of the (a) smallest, (b) average, and (c) largest caseloads for (i) work coaches and (ii) other members of staff working on the processing and administration of universal credit claims in each of the most recent three years for which data is available.
